Social Strategist
Overview:
The pharmaceutical industry is rife with opportunity for social strategy. The need for strategic social guidance has become even more important as more brands are pursuing social and feeling comfortable moving in to the space.
Saatchi Wellness is looking for a Social Strategist that is hungry to own strategic development and can think outside the box. Someone who understands the wider digital landscape, influencer marketing and an understanding of media channels with a strong focus on social. They will be responsible for strategy, execution, and assisting clients on a daily basis to meet their business goals. The ideal candidate has a strong sense of the social media landscape and can apply creative and innovative thinking to a heavily regulated industry.
Qualifications and Experience:
- Proven work experience as a Social Media Strategist or Social Media Manager, (2-3 years experience in strategic role)
- In-depth knowledge of major social platforms including but not limited to, Facebook, Twitter, YouTube, Pinterest, Instagram, Reddit, and TikTok
- Proficient in developing social creative briefs and campaigns
- Develop strategic rationale for platforms, based on client objectives and consumer needs
- Able to identify new areas of growth, new potential audiences, and new platforms with which to expand the social media presence
- Craft social personas for the social brand tone and voice
- Develop program mechanics and executional considerations
- Convert product information & facts into authentic social narratives
- Ability to generate data-based insights to utilize in to the strategic process
- Informed and knowledgeable of relevant cultural trends, movements, memes, and social media best practices
- Understand how to execute social campaigns and implement more advanced social campaigns (Experiential, Influencer, UGC)
- Experience in assembling competitive and social landscape audits
- Strong exposure to Community/Content Management tools, such as Sprout, Hootsuite, Netbase, Sysomos, Spredfast, and Sprinklr, etc.
- Well versed in Community Management and Response protocol, publishing content and responding to consumer inquires
- Experience in media planning, comms planning or buying is a plus but is not required
- Partner with Creative team to help ensure content is appealing and works well in the social space
- Knowledge in the healthcare advertising and HCP social is not required
